拆解九号电瓶车控制器,做工很厉害
芯世相· 2025-09-13 03:58
Core Viewpoint - The article discusses a significant find of a nearly new Ninebot electric scooter controller purchased for only 28 yuan, highlighting its impressive build quality and components [7][9][78]. Group 1: Product Overview - The controller model ZWK048020A was noted for its excellent condition and recent manufacturing date of November 2024, suggesting minimal usage [9]. - The controller features a power control architecture with a metal base and a separate control board, which enhances thermal management and reduces manufacturing complexity [78]. Group 2: Component Analysis - The power board contains 12 MOSFETs from Silan Micro, specifically the SVG105R4NS, rated at 100V and 120A, with a low on-resistance of 5 milliohms [32]. - The control board utilizes an AT32F415CCT7 microcontroller from Aotule, and includes two TLV9084 chips from Texas Instruments for current sampling [62][64]. - The controller employs a CAN bus system, which limits its usability across different vehicles, contributing to its low resale value [66]. Group 3: Design Features - The controller's design includes robust protection for signal ports and a heavy metal casing, weighing approximately 1 pound, which is likely made of cast iron [72][78]. - The separation of the power and control boards allows for better heat dissipation and higher current handling, while also simplifying the design and reducing costs [78].
海陵高新区攀高逐新提能级
Xin Hua Ri Bao· 2025-08-18 22:00
Group 1 - Jiangsu's power grid reached a historical peak load this summer, with the "super battery" independent energy storage station in Haizhou High-tech Zone ensuring electricity supply for enterprises and residents, dispatching 1.7 million kWh daily since July [1] - The Taizhou Feima Vehicle Parts Co., Ltd. invested 5 million yuan to upgrade automation equipment, achieving full-process automation and a daily output of 45,000 parts, expected to complete last year's total business volume within the first eight months of this year [1] - The Taizhou New Energy Industrial Park was upgraded to a provincial high-tech industrial development zone, focusing on high-end, intelligent, and green development to contribute to the goal of becoming a "trillion-dollar main city" [1] Group 2 - The Taizhou New Energy Industrial Park, established in 2010, transitioned from a traditional park to a modern one under the leadership of the "Jiulong Town + Haineng Group" model, achieving a qualitative upgrade from a municipal park to a provincial high-tech zone [2] - The park aims to build a "main and two special" industrial system, with a focus on new energy as a landmark industry, supporting the growth of equipment manufacturing and smart home industries through technological innovation [2] - The production line of the photovoltaic component junction box project at Shidi Photovoltaic Technology (Taizhou) Co., Ltd. is set to be operational by July 2024, with a rapid construction timeline of 315 days from land acquisition to production [2] Group 3 - Shidi Photovoltaic's Taizhou company, invested by Sichuan Shidi New Energy Co., Ltd., aims for an annual production capacity of 200 GW for photovoltaic component junction boxes, achieving over 95% automation in production processes [3] - The company is positioned to become the highest standard production base for junction boxes in the industry, providing reliable products for efficient photovoltaic systems [3] Group 4 - The Haizhou High-tech Zone has attracted several leading photovoltaic companies, including Jiangsu Longi and Haineng New Energy, covering downstream sectors of the industry chain, achieving "wall-to-wall supply" for industrial support [4] - Companies like Kangqian Machinery and Yulong Technology are leading in their respective fields, with Kangqian holding over 25% market share in precision GIS aluminum alloy castings and exporting to multiple countries [5] - The Haizhou High-tech Zone aims to enhance its development capabilities and foster a competitive ecosystem, focusing on nurturing specialized and innovative enterprises [6]
